Abstract

<P>PROBLEM TO BE SOLVED: To eliminate a flutter when an operating lever held to a direction-indicating position of a vehicle by a moderating mechanism is returned by steering operation to the opposite direction of the direction indication of the vehicle; or to prevent the operating lever from reaching the opposite direction-indicating position. <P>SOLUTION: When the operating lever 2 is operated from the neutral position, a moderate plate 7 is biased to a moderate piece 6 and oscillated, and the angle of the moderate plate 7 relative to the moderate piece 6 is changed. Since the moderate plate 7 returns to the moderate trough-shaped part 9 of the neutral position and the ascending angle of the moderate chevron-shaped part 12 further ahead is made to be large by changing of the angle of the moderate plate 7 and by the resistance applied to the oscillation (return oscillation) of the moderate plate 7 with a resistance applying means, the progress of the moderate piece 6 is restricted. The operating lever 2 is prevented from further progressing or hardly progress even it reaches to the original position. <P>COPYRIGHT: (C)2007,JPO&INPIT

本発明は、車両の方向指示位置で保持された操作レバーを、その指示した方向とは反対の方向のステアリング操作で戻す構造に改良を加えた車両用方向指示装置に関する。   The present invention relates to a vehicular direction indicating device in which an operation lever held at a direction indicating position of a vehicle is returned by a steering operation in a direction opposite to the instructed direction.

従来より、車両、特に自動車においては、ステアリングホイールの近傍に操作レバーが具えられ、その操作レバーを使用者が操作することによって、車両の右左折の方向指示がなされるようになっており、操作レバーは節度機構により中立位置並びに上記右左折の方向指示位置で保持されるようになっている。節度機構は、操作レバーを支持する車両用方向指示装置のボディに複数の節度山部と交互に形成された節度谷部と、操作レバー側からその節度山部及び節度谷部方向に付勢された節度ピースから成っており、その節度ピースが節度谷部と係合することで、操作レバーを上記中立位置並びに上記右左折の方向指示位置で保持するようになっている。そして、その方向指示位置に保持した操作レバーを、その指示した方向とは反対の方向のステアリング操作で戻すようになっている(例えば特許文献1参照)。
特開平7-320595号公報
Conventionally, an operation lever is provided in the vicinity of a steering wheel in a vehicle, in particular, an automobile, and a user operates the operation lever to instruct the vehicle to turn left or right. The lever is held by the moderation mechanism at the neutral position and the direction indicating position of the right / left turn. The moderation mechanism is biased in the direction of the moderation peak portion and the moderation valley portion from the operation lever side, and the moderation valley portion formed alternately with a plurality of moderation peak portions on the body of the vehicle direction indicating device that supports the control lever. The moderation piece engages with the moderation trough, so that the operation lever is held at the neutral position and at the right / left turn direction indicating position. Then, the operation lever held at the direction indicating position is returned by a steering operation in a direction opposite to the instructed direction (see, for example, Patent Document 1).
Japanese Unexamined Patent Publication No. 7-320595

しかしながら、上述のように節度機構で車両の方向指示位置に保持した操作レバーを、指示した方向とは反対の方向のステアリング操作で戻したとき、節度機構では、節度ピースが、節度山部を越えて、与えられた付勢力のままに斜面部を急速に滑り降り、それに操作レバーの重量による自走エネルギーが加わることによって、操作レバーが源位置(中立位置)に至ってもなお進み、その結果、操作レバーが源位置を越えて、その後、戻ることにより、ばたつくということがあり、もしくは、戻ることもなく反対の方向指示位置まで至って、反対の方向指示がなされてしまうという可能性があった。   However, when the operating lever held at the vehicle direction indication position by the moderation mechanism as described above is returned by the steering operation in the direction opposite to the instructed direction, the moderation piece causes the moderation piece to exceed the moderation peak. As a result, the control lever continues to move even if it reaches the source position (neutral position) by sliding down the slope rapidly with the given urging force and adding self-propelled energy due to the weight of the control lever. There is a possibility that the lever may flutter when the lever moves beyond the source position and then returns, or the opposite direction indication position is reached without returning to the opposite direction indication position.

本発明は上述の事情に鑑みてなされたものであり、従ってその目的は、節度機構で車両の方向指示位置に保持した操作レバーを、指示した方向とは反対の方向のステアリング操作で戻したときの、操作レバーのばたつきをなくし、もしくは操作レバーが反対の方向指示位置まで至ることのないようにし得る車両用方向指示装置を提供するにある。   The present invention has been made in view of the above circumstances, and therefore the object thereof is to return the operation lever held at the vehicle direction indication position by the moderation mechanism by the steering operation in the direction opposite to the indicated direction. It is an object of the present invention to provide a vehicular direction indicating device that can eliminate fluttering of the operating lever or prevent the operating lever from reaching the opposite direction indicating position.

上記目的を達成するために、本発明の車両用方向指示装置は、使用者により操作される操作レバーと、この操作レバーを中立位置、右折方向指示位置、左折方向指示位置に保持する節度機構とを具備し、前記右折方向指示位置、左折方向指示位置に保持された操作レバーを、その指示した方向とは反対の方向のステアリング操作で戻すようにしたものにおいて、前記節度機構が、複数の節度山部と交互に節度谷部を有する節度プレートと、前記操作レバー側から前記節度プレートの節度山部及び節度谷部方向に付勢された節度ピースから成り、その節度ピースが前記節度谷部と係合することで前記操作レバーを前記中立位置、右折方向指示位置、左折方向指示位置に保持するものであって、前記節度プレートを前記操作レバーの操作方向と同方向に揺動可能に設けると共に、この節度プレートの揺動に抵抗を与える抵抗付与手段を設けたことを特徴とする。   In order to achieve the above object, a vehicle direction indicating device of the present invention includes an operation lever operated by a user, and a moderation mechanism that holds the operation lever at a neutral position, a right turn direction instruction position, and a left turn direction instruction position. The operation lever held at the right turn direction indication position and the left turn direction indication position is returned by a steering operation in a direction opposite to the indicated direction. It comprises a moderation plate having moderation valleys alternately with ridges, and a moderation piece urged from the operation lever side toward the moderation ridges and moderation valleys of the moderation plate, the moderation piece being the moderation valley and By engaging, the operation lever is held at the neutral position, the right turn direction instruction position, and the left turn direction instruction position, and the moderation plate is kept in the same direction as the operation direction of the operation lever. With swingably provided direction, characterized in that a resistance applying means for applying a resistance to the swinging of the detent plate.

上記手段によれば、操作レバーを中立位置から操作したとき、節度プレートが節度ピースに振られて揺動され、節度ピースに対する節度プレートの角度が変化する。この節度プレートの角度が変化することと、節度プレートの揺動(戻り揺動)に抵抗付与手段で抵抗が与えられることとで、節度機構により車両の方向指示位置に保持した操作レバーを、指示した方向とは反対の方向のステアリング操作で戻したときには、節度ピースが中立位置の節度谷部に戻ってなお進もうとする先の節度山部の登り角度が大きくなっており、節度ピースの進行が制される。かくして、操作レバーが源位置に至ってもなお進められるということがなくなるか、もしくは少なくなる。その結果、操作レバーがばたつくことがなくなり、もしくは、反対の方向指示位置まで至ることがなくなる。   According to the above means, when the operation lever is operated from the neutral position, the moderation plate is swung by the moderation piece, and the angle of the moderation plate with respect to the moderation piece changes. By changing the angle of the moderation plate and applying resistance to the swinging (returning swinging) of the moderation plate by the resistance applying means, the operating lever held at the vehicle direction indication position is indicated by the moderation mechanism. When the steering operation is reversed in the opposite direction, the moderation piece returns to the neutral moderation valley, and the climbing angle of the previous moderation mountain increases and the progress of the moderation piece Is controlled. Thus, even if the operating lever reaches the source position, it will not be advanced or less. As a result, the operation lever does not flutter or does not reach the opposite direction indication position.

以下、本発明の一実施例(一実施形態)につき、図面を参照して説明する。
まず、図2には、車両用、特には自動車用の方向指示装置の全体的構成を示しており、ボディ1、中でもボディ本体1aに、操作レバー2を軸部3を中心として上下に回動可能に支持している。ボディ1は、上記ボディ本体1aと、図3及び図4に示すボディカバー1bとから成っており、ボディカバー1bはボディ本体1aの前面(図2の紙面と直交する方向の手前側)に被着している。
Hereinafter, an example (one embodiment) of the present invention will be described with reference to the drawings.
First, FIG. 2 shows the overall configuration of a direction indicator device for a vehicle, particularly an automobile, and the operation lever 2 is pivoted up and down around the shaft portion 3 on the body 1, especially the body main body 1a. I support it as possible. The body 1 includes the body main body 1a and the body cover 1b shown in FIGS. 3 and 4, and the body cover 1b is attached to the front surface of the body main body 1a (the front side in the direction perpendicular to the paper surface of FIG. 2). ing.

これに対して、操作レバー2は、レバー本体2aと、これを取付けたブラケット2bとから成っており、ブラケット2bが上記軸部3を有している。この操作レバー2は使用者によりレバー本体2a側で上下に操作されるもので、下方への操作が車両の左折方向指示のため、上方への操作が車両の右折方向指示のためである。   On the other hand, the operation lever 2 includes a lever body 2 a and a bracket 2 b to which the lever body 2 a is attached. The bracket 2 b has the shaft portion 3. The operation lever 2 is operated up and down by the user on the lever body 2a side, and the downward operation is for instructing the vehicle to turn left and the upward operation is for instructing the vehicle to turn right.

ブラケット2bには、レバー本体2a側とは反対の側(図2で右側)に穴4を形成しており、この穴4に圧縮コイルスプリング5を収納し、このスプリング5の先端に節度ピース6を配置している。節度ピース6は、この場合、先端部が半球状を成す砲弾形のものである。   A hole 4 is formed in the bracket 2b on the side opposite to the lever body 2a side (the right side in FIG. 2). A compression coil spring 5 is accommodated in the hole 4, and the moderation piece 6 is placed at the tip of the spring 5. Is arranged. In this case, the moderation piece 6 has a bullet shape with a hemispherical tip.

一方、ボディ本体1aには、節度ピース6と対向する部分に節度プレート7を配置している。この節度プレート7は、節度ピース6側に節度谷部8,9,10を上下方向に並べて有するもので、その節度谷部8,9,10の各間は節度山部11,12であり、従って、節度谷部8,9,10は複数(この場合、2つ)の節度山部11,12と交互に存在している。又、特に中央の節度谷部9から両側の節度山部11,12にかけての斜面部は、勾配を等しくしている。   On the other hand, a moderation plate 7 is disposed on the body main body 1 a at a portion facing the moderation piece 6. This moderation plate 7 has moderation valley portions 8, 9, 10 arranged in the vertical direction on the moderation piece 6 side, and between the moderation valley portions 8, 9, 10 is a moderation mountain portion 11, 12. Accordingly, the moderation valley portions 8, 9, and 10 are alternately present with a plurality (in this case, two) of the moderation mountain portions 11 and 12. In particular, the slopes from the central moderation valley 9 to the moderation peaks 11 and 12 on both sides have the same gradient.

更に、節度プレート7は、中央の節度谷部9が存在する中央部を、軸部13によってボディ本体1aに揺動可能に取付け支持している。ここで、節度プレート7の揺動方向は、時計回り及び反時計回りであり、前記操作レバー2の回動方向(上下)も時計回り及び反時計回りであって、要するに、それら節度プレート7と操作レバー2は、同方向に動作可能に設けている。   Further, the moderation plate 7 supports and supports the central portion where the central moderation valley portion 9 exists on the body body 1a by the shaft portion 13 so as to be swingable. Here, the swinging direction of the moderation plate 7 is clockwise and counterclockwise, and the rotation direction (up and down) of the operation lever 2 is also clockwise and counterclockwise. The operation lever 2 is provided so as to be operable in the same direction.

しかして、前記節度ピース6はスプリング5の弾発力でこの節度谷部8,9,10及び節度山部11,12方向に付勢されており、その付勢力で節度谷部の1つ(図2に示す例は中央の節度谷部9)に節度ピース6が圧接して係合し、これらの節度谷部8,9,10及び節度山部11,12と節度ピース6及びスプリング5とによって節度機構14を組成している。   Thus, the moderation piece 6 is urged in the direction of the moderation valley portions 8, 9, 10 and the moderation mountain portions 11 and 12 by the elastic force of the spring 5, and one of the moderation valley portions (by the urging force ( In the example shown in FIG. 2, the moderation piece 6 is pressed and engaged with the central moderation valley portion 9), the moderation valley portions 8, 9, 10 and the moderation mountain portions 11 and 12, the moderation piece 6 and the spring 5 Thus, the moderation mechanism 14 is composed.

そして、節度プレート7の上下両端部の前面部には、凸部15,16を形成しており、前記ボディ1のボディカバー1bの内面部には、図3及び図4に示すように、それらの凸部15,16の突端部が係合する凹部17,18を形成している。   And the convex parts 15 and 16 are formed in the front part of the up-and-down both ends of the moderation plate 7, As shown in FIG.3 and FIG.4, as shown in FIG.3 and FIG.4 in the inner surface part of the body cover 1b of the said body 1 Concave portions 17 and 18 are formed in which the projecting ends of the convex portions 15 and 16 are engaged.

このほか、ボディ1のボディ本体1aには、図示を省略するが、操作レバー2の操作に応じて車両の右折方向指示、左折方向指示をするためのスイッチを配設しており、又、ブラケット2bには、これも図示を省略するが、キャンセル受け部材であるラチェットを設けていて、これの先端部をボディ本体1a外(特には図2で左方)に突出させ、図示しないステアリングホイールと一体に回動するキャンセル部材であるキャンセルカム(これも図示せず)に対応させている。   In addition, although not shown, the body body 1a of the body 1 is provided with a switch for instructing the vehicle to turn right or turn left in accordance with the operation of the operation lever 2, and the bracket. Although not shown in FIG. 2b, the ratchet 2b is provided with a ratchet which is a cancel receiving member. The tip of the ratchet protrudes outside the body body 1a (particularly leftward in FIG. 2), and a steering wheel (not shown) It is made to respond | correspond to the cancellation cam (this is not shown) which is the cancellation member rotated integrally.

次に、上記構成のものの作用を述べる。
節度機構14の節度ピース6がスプリング5の弾発力で中央の節度谷部9に圧接して係合した図2の状態にあるとき、操作レバー2は中立位置に保持されている。
Next, the operation of the above configuration will be described.
When the moderation piece 6 of the moderation mechanism 14 is in the state of FIG. 2 in which the moderation piece 6 is pressed and engaged with the central moderation valley 9 by the elastic force of the spring 5, the operation lever 2 is held in the neutral position.

この中立位置から、使用者が操作レバー2をレバー本体2a側で下方に操作すると、図1に実線で示すように、操作レバー2はブラケット2bの軸部3を中心に反時計回りに回動する。このとき、節度機構14においては、上記中央の節度谷部9に係合していた節度ピース6が、上方の節度山部11に至る斜面部を登り、その過程で節度プレート7を押す。押された節度プレート7は、図5及び図6に示すように、凸部15,16をボディカバー1bの凹部17,18から離脱させてボディカバー1bの内面に摺接させつつ、図1で時計回りに揺動し、節度ピース6に対する角度を変化させる。そして、節度山部11を越えた節度ピース6が上方の節度谷部8に移り、この節度谷部8に圧接して係合する。これにより、操作レバー2は図1に実線で示す左折方向指示位置に保持される。又、それにより、ボディ本体1a内では、車両の左折方向指示をするためのスイッチが応動し、車両の左折方向指示がなされる。   From this neutral position, when the user operates the operating lever 2 downward on the lever body 2a side, the operating lever 2 rotates counterclockwise about the shaft portion 3 of the bracket 2b as shown by the solid line in FIG. To do. At this time, in the moderation mechanism 14, the moderation piece 6 that has been engaged with the central moderation valley portion 9 climbs the slope portion that reaches the upper moderation mountain portion 11 and pushes the moderation plate 7 in the process. As shown in FIGS. 5 and 6, the pushed moderation plate 7 is rotated clockwise in FIG. 1 while the convex portions 15 and 16 are disengaged from the concave portions 17 and 18 of the body cover 1b and slidably contact the inner surface of the body cover 1b. The angle with respect to the moderation piece 6 is changed. Then, the moderation piece 6 beyond the moderation peak portion 11 moves to the upper moderation valley portion 8 and presses and engages with the moderation valley portion 8. As a result, the operation lever 2 is held at the left turn direction indicating position indicated by the solid line in FIG. Accordingly, in the body main body 1a, the switch for instructing the left turn direction of the vehicle responds and the left turn direction of the vehicle is instructed.

一方、前記中立位置から、使用者が操作レバー2をレバー本体2a側で上方に操作すると、図示しないが、操作レバー2はブラケット2bの軸部3を中心に時計回りに回動する。このとき、節度機構14においては、上記中央の節度谷部9に係合していた節度ピース6が、下方の節度山部12に至る斜面部を登り、その過程で節度プレート7を押す。押された節度プレート7は、これも図示しないが、凸部15,16をボディカバー1bの凹部17,18から上述とは反対の方向に離脱させてボディカバー1bの内面に摺接させつつ、反時計回りに揺動し、節度ピース6に対する角度を変化させる。そして、節度山部12を越えた節度ピース6が下方の節度谷部10に移り、この節度谷部10に圧接して係合する。これにより、操作レバー2は右折方向指示位置に保持される。又、それにより、ボディ本体1a内では、車両の右折方向指示をするためのスイッチが応動し、車両の右折方向指示がなされる。   On the other hand, when the user operates the operation lever 2 upward on the lever body 2a side from the neutral position, although not shown, the operation lever 2 rotates clockwise around the shaft portion 3 of the bracket 2b. At this time, in the moderation mechanism 14, the moderation piece 6 that has been engaged with the central moderation valley 9 climbs the slope reaching the moderation mountain 12 below and pushes the moderation plate 7 in the process. The pressed moderation plate 7 is not shown in the figure, but the convex portions 15 and 16 are separated from the concave portions 17 and 18 of the body cover 1b in the direction opposite to the above and are brought into sliding contact with the inner surface of the body cover 1b. The angle with respect to the moderating piece 6 is changed. Then, the moderation piece 6 beyond the moderation peak portion 12 moves to the moderation valley portion 10 below, and presses and engages the moderation valley portion 10. Thereby, the operation lever 2 is held at the right turn direction instruction position. Accordingly, in the body main body 1a, the switch for instructing the right turn direction of the vehicle responds, and the right turn direction of the vehicle is instructed.

さて、このように操作レバー2が左折方向指示位置又は右折方向指示位置に保持された状態にあるとき、その指示した方向とは反対の方向にステアリングホイールが回転操作されると、ステアリングホイールと一体に回転するキャンセルカムにより、ラチェットが動作されることに応じて、操作レバー2は中立位置に向け戻される。   Now, when the operation lever 2 is held at the left turn direction indicating position or the right turn direction indicating position as described above, when the steering wheel is rotated in the direction opposite to the indicated direction, the steering lever is integrated with the steering wheel. The operating lever 2 is returned to the neutral position in response to the ratchet being operated by the cancel cam that rotates in the forward direction.

このとき、節度ピース6は、節度山部11又は節度山部12を越え、そしてスプリング5によって与えられた付勢力のままに、節度山部11から節度谷部9へ又は節度山部12から節度谷部9へ至る斜面部を滑り降りるが、節度谷部9に戻ってなお進もうとする先の節度山部12又は11の登り角度は、節度プレート7が先の操作レバー2の操作で揺動し節度ピース6に対する角度を変化させていることで大きくなっている。   At this time, the moderation piece 6 crosses the moderation peak 11 or the moderation peak 12 and maintains the biasing force applied by the spring 5 from the moderation peak 11 to the moderation valley 9 or moderation from the moderation peak 12. Although the slope angle to the valley 9 is slid down, the climb angle of the previous moderation mountain 12 or 11 which is going to return to the moderation valley 9 and still proceed is that the moderation plate 7 is swung by the operation of the previous operation lever 2 However, the angle is increased by changing the angle with respect to the moderation piece 6.

加えて、このときには凸部15,16がボディカバー1bの内面に圧接し、節度プレート7の揺動に抵抗を与えるようになっており、すなわち、凸部15,16がボディカバー1bの内面との間で、節度プレート7の揺動に抵抗を与える抵抗付与手段として機能するようになっている。このため、節度ピース6の進行が節度プレート7の登り角度の大きくなった節度山部12又は11の斜面部で制され、かくして、操作レバー2が源位置に至ってもなお進められるということがなくなるか、もしくは少なくなる。その結果、操作レバー2がばたつくことがなくなり、もしくは、反対の方向指示位置まで至ることがなくなる。   In addition, at this time, the convex portions 15 and 16 are pressed against the inner surface of the body cover 1b to give resistance to the swing of the moderation plate 7, that is, the convex portions 15 and 16 are between the inner surface of the body cover 1b. Thus, it functions as a resistance applying means that gives resistance to the oscillation of the moderation plate 7. For this reason, the progress of the moderation piece 6 is controlled by the slope portion of the moderation mountain portion 12 or 11 where the climbing angle of the moderation plate 7 is increased, and thus the operation lever 2 is not advanced even when it reaches the source position. Or less. As a result, the operation lever 2 does not flutter or does not reach the opposite direction indication position.

なお、節度プレート7は、上述のように凸部15,16がボディカバー1bの内面に圧接することによる抵抗力で節度ピース6の進行を制しつつも、その節度ピース6の進行力を受けることで、やがては源位置に戻され、凸部15,16がボディカバー1bの凹部17,18にそれぞれ係合することで源位置に保持される。   The moderation plate 7 receives the traveling force of the moderation piece 6 while restricting the progress of the moderation piece 6 by the resistance force caused by the protrusions 15 and 16 being pressed against the inner surface of the body cover 1b as described above. As a result, it is returned to the source position and is held at the source position by engaging the convex portions 15 and 16 with the concave portions 17 and 18 of the body cover 1b.

このように本構成のものでは、操作レバー2を中立位置、右折方向指示位置、左折方向指示位置に保持する節度機構14を、複数の節度山部11,12と交互に節度谷部8,9,10を有する節度プレート7と、操作レバー2側から節度プレート7の節度山部11,12及び節度谷部8〜10方向に付勢された節度ピース6とによって構成し、その節度プレート7を操作レバー2の操作方向と同方向に揺動可能に設けると共に、この節度プレート7の揺動に抵抗を与える抵抗付与手段を設けたことにより、節度機構14で車両の方向指示位置に係止した操作レバー2をその指示した方向とは反対の方向のステアリング操作で戻したときの、操作レバー2のばたつきをなくすことができ、もしくは操作レバー2が反対の方向指示位置まで至ることのないようにすることができて、反対の方向指示がなされてしまうことのないようにできる。   As described above, in this configuration, the moderation mechanism 14 that holds the operation lever 2 at the neutral position, the right turn direction indication position, and the left turn direction indication position is provided with the moderation valley portions 8 and 9 alternately with the plurality of moderation mountain portions 11 and 12. , 10 and a moderation piece 6 urged in the direction of the moderation peak portions 11 and 12 and the moderation valley portions 8 to 10 of the moderation plate 7 from the operation lever 2 side. In addition to being provided so as to be able to swing in the same direction as the operating direction of the operating lever 2 and by providing resistance applying means for giving resistance to the swinging of the moderation plate 7, the moderation mechanism 14 is locked at the vehicle direction indication position. When the operation lever 2 is returned by the steering operation in the direction opposite to the direction instructed, the fluttering of the operation lever 2 can be eliminated or the operation lever 2 can reach the opposite direction indication position. And it can ensure that no can so as not to reverse direction indication will be made.
